About Augusta High

Augusta High is an one-room-style four-year high school in Augusta, Wisconsin, one of the schools within Augusta School District. The school instructs 144 students in grades 9 through 12. That puts it 70% smaller than the typical public school in Wisconsin, which averages around 475 students.

Augusta High is one of 4 schools operated by Augusta School District, a district that caters to 540 students overall.

Looking at the student body, Augusta High logs that 92% of students identify as White, making the school strongly White-majority. The remainder reads as 3% Hispanic, 3% multiracial.

On the resource side, Staff filings list 19 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 7.6:1 students per teacher. The state averages around 14.6: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. Around 53% of the student body qualifies for free or reduced-price meals,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. That share is above Eau Claire County's rate of about 37%.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, Augusta High s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 44.8%; this one delivers 38.2%.

Zooming out to the county, the surrounding county (Eau Claire County) records that median household income runs about $74,546, roughly 37%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 6% of residents live below the federal poverty line. Across Eau Claire County's 36 public schools (combined enrollment of about 14,002 students), Augusta High is one campus in the mix.

The closest other public school is Augusta Middle, roughly 0.0 miles away. Within five miles, there are 2 other public schools.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Augusta High at 8th of 9; the average score across the group is 49.8%.

Augusta High operates from a small-town location.

Five-year trend. Over the past 7-year window, the student count fell 5%: 151 students in 2018 compared to 144 in 2025. The White share of enrollment grew from 85% to 92% over that span. The student-to-teacher ratio pulled in from 10.8:1 in 2018 to 7.6:1 today.
